    While Spider-Man and Spider-man 2 set the bar higher for excellence in comic book adaptions, Spider-Man 3 the latest installment in the hugely popular series is a massive step down from those two. It has far too many plot lines and too many villains and that just makes it a cr...( read more)owed mess. While it does boast some really dazzling action sequences and some cool fights in the film, it still can't be saved or salvaged from the over use of everything in Spider-Man3.





    Spider-Man 3 tries to elevate the feel and hyper kinetic style of the film with over blown action sequences and on par CGI. But that's not what we need in Spider-Man, no what we need in this film is stronger emotional conviction, more sorrow and a deeper look into the power that turns men in monsters. But sadly we got what Sam Rami thought what audiences would want extreme action, a dark setting(which I liked.) and gloomy style, which is good in all but still can't make up for the lack of care taken to make this movie. As you watch it you feel like your watching Die Hard or a Mark Whalberg movie it doesn't take it's time to tell just one story, it has to tell five: Parker's, Osbourne's, Watson, Brock's, Marko It's just too crowded and contrived at times and really that brings down the value of the film and the high hopes of a highly acclaimed and thoroughly enjoyable third movie. Instead we get a poorly made, adequately acted and jumble film that has high entertainment values but none of the heart of the first two.




    Tobey Maguire(Who is a real let down here.) Tries his hardest but can't seem to elevate this film past normal or mediocre if you will. You can see clearly see in some scenes that he is pushing ever so hard to be bad and evil as the film suggest but he can't pull it off, even when he's suppose to have his revelation and go back to good it's not that powerful, but he tries and I will give him the befit of the doubt. Kirsten Dunst(Who was totally annoying here.) is nothing short of bad and just her usual,nothing new self here. She doesn't push hard enough to make her character believable all she does is just stand there and look pretty which is good an all but not enough to say she was good. Topher Grace(Who hired this wimp again?) Is neither good or convincing as the sadistic and all powerful Venom, I felt like he was just another High School bully for Parker to wipe the floor with, I wasn't scared or in awe of Venom, Grace turned him into a cowardly punk instead of the head on villain Venom is, Grace just plain sucks in this and is one of the main reasons this film fails. The cast tries and fails to give this film a good reputation but they can't, they fall and fall hard on the over reliance of CGI and the poor script, but none the less they do adequately here.




    Spider-Man 3 is great fun but not great film making, It's a good look at how too much power can corrupt a man and turn a hero into an evil tyrant. But beyond those two good qualities everything else here fails miserable and is just poor entertainment and not as good as it could have been. All in all Spider-Man 3 is an A-Bomb.

    4 of 5 stars for the comic book based movie Spider-Man 3. Of the three Spider-Man movies, this is the most complex with the deepest focus on the main characters. Tobey Maguire & Kristen Dunst return in the key roles. The overall plot is about a strange black creature arrives on t...( read more)he Earth and ultimately bonds with Peter Parker making a "black Spider-man". There are several sub-plots in the movie which add to the complexity of the story. There is Harry the son of the bad guy from Spider-Man 2 who first wants revenge for the death of his father, then loses his memory and ultimately things work out OK. There is the "SandMan" who was the guy who really killed Parker's father; able to shift any/all of his body to sand he is difficult to fight. And then there is the engagement of Parker and MJ; well maybe.

    As with all of the other Spider-Man movies, this one is extremely well made with good story, good characters and good action. Good special effects. The only reason for not giving a 5 star is the complexity of the plot which doesn't seem to flow well.
